Taiwan Stocks Retreat 220 Points as TSMC Holds Steady; Memory and Financial Sectors Attract Buying

Electronic Technology · Semiconductors · cnyes · 2026-09-09

The Taiwan Stock Exchange index fell 220 points in a volatile session, with TSMC providing support while profit-taking hit robotics and component stocks.

What Happened

Market Overview: The Taiwan stock market experienced a volatile session, opening higher before succumbing to profit-taking and selling pressure, ultimately closing down 220.49 points at 47,105.78. Trading volume remained high as the index retreated from its intraday highs, reflecting a cautious sentiment near short-term moving averages.

Strong Sectors: The memory industry saw gains as AI server demand tightened supply for HBM and DDR5, driving contract prices higher and boosting stocks like Nanya Technology and Winbond. Meanwhile, the financial sector attracted defensive capital due to strong earnings and high dividend yields, with major players like E.Sun Financial and Mega Financial showing resilience.

Weak Performers: Robotics and bearing stocks faced significant profit-taking after recent rallies, leading to pullbacks in companies like AirTAC International and Hiwin Technologies. Passive component manufacturers also struggled as broad market selling pressure weighed on names such as Yageo and Walsin Technology, indicating a shift toward risk mitigation.

Institutional Activity: Institutional investors were net sellers in the main market, with a notable divergence between foreign investors and domestic investment trusts. While foreign capital showed interest in large-cap stocks, domestic trusts were active in supporting the OTC market, highlighting a split in strategic positioning between local and international players.
